POSITION TITLE: Bartender/Server
REPORTS TO: Bar Supervisor/AGM/GM

POSITION SUMMARY

The Bartender/Server is responsible for preparing and serving alcoholic and non-alcoholic beverages, interacting with guests, taking orders, and serving food and drinks. The role goes beyond mixing drinks, as bartender/server, you are expected to provide a memorable guest experience by engaging with guests and ensuring the bar operates efficiently and flawlessly. D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Prepare and serve alcoholic and non-alcoholic beverages for bar patrons according to standard recipes.
    • Greet guests, answer questions, and make recommendations based on guest preferences and menu offerings.
    • Take drink and food orders from guests or servers, ensuring timely service.
    • Properly record all sales transactions and ensure accurate payment & cash handling.
    • Perform opening and closing side work according to checklists, ensuring the bar , pool deck and restaurant is clean and organized.
    • Wash glassware and maintain the cleanliness of the bar and surrounding areas.
    • Stay knowledgeable about current food and beverage offerings, including wine lists and cocktail menus.
    • Provide guests with current information regarding hotel services, hours, and local attractions.
    • Perform other duties as assigned by management to enhance guest experiences and bar operations.
    QUALIFICATIONS
    • 3 to 6 months of related experience; or one-year certificate from college or technical school; or equivalent combination of education and experience.
    • Exceptional customer service skills, with a strong focus on creating memorable guest experiences.
    • Excellent communication skills and the ability to establish rapport with guests and team members.
    • Self-motivated with a strong work ethic and attention to detail.
    • Ability to lift 20lbs.
